WebWhat Type Of Word Is Effort? “Effort” is a noun. We use it to talk about an attempt to do something, and it’s only ever written in the noun form. Because it is a noun, we usually need other words to accompany it for it to make sense in a sentence. We might need a verb, like so: Make an effort; Or an adjective, like so: A great effort

WebAug 25, 2015 · As to the preposition 'of', it is used to invert a noun adjunct (noun-noun sequence) without change in meaning: Horse mane >> The mane of a horse Car engine >> The engine of a car. In this case one can say "trapping effort", or one can say "effort of trapping", but the meaning is different than with the preposition "in" or "at". WebJul 17, 2024 · Effort noun.
